Commercial Building Demolition in Houston, TX
Commercial building demolition services involve the careful removal and teardown of existing structures on a property, typically when preparing for new development or renovations. These projects can include the demolition of office buildings, retail spaces, warehouses, or other large-scale structures. Property owners often seek these services to clear land efficiently, ensure safety during the demolition process, and comply with local regulations. It is important to understand the scope of work, including site preparation, debris removal, and any necessary permits, before requesting a demolition service.
Homeowners and property owners should consider the size and type of the building, as well as the potential impact on neighboring properties, when planning for demolition. Clarifying whether the project involves partial or complete removal, and understanding the timeline and logistical requirements, can help ensure a smooth process. Proper planning and communication about the project’s specifics can aid in coordinating the demolition safely and efficiently, making way for future development or property improvements.

Commercial Building Demolition Questions
What types of commercial buildings are suitable for demolition? Any structure such as warehouses, office buildings, retail centers, or industrial facilities can be considered for demolition depending on project needs.
What should property owners know before starting a demolition project? It's important to assess the building's structure, understand local regulations, and plan for proper site clearance and safety measures.
Are there specific permits required for commercial building demolition? Yes, local permits are typically needed to ensure the demolition complies with city and state regulations.
What are common reasons for choosing commercial demolition services? Reasons include building obsolescence, redevelopment plans, structural issues, or preparing the site for new construction.
